Common Issues with Double French Doors
Before diving into repairs, it's vital to comprehend the common issues property owners may face with double French doors. Here's a comprehensive table that describes these issues, their prospective causes, and recommended solutions.
| Problem | Possible Causes | Suggested Solutions |
|---|---|---|
| Distorted Doors | Humidity, temperature level modifications | Utilize a level, adjust hinges, or change the door |
| Trouble Closing | Misalignment or particles | Straighten the door or clear any blockages |
| Cracked or Broken Glass | Impact damage or severe weather condition | Replace the glass pane or the entire door |
| Drafts or Air Leaks | Used weather condition stripping | Replace weather removing |
| Sticking Lock | Rust or dirt build-up | Tidy and oil the lock mechanism |
| Squeaky Hinges | Lack of lubrication | Apply a silicone spray or grease to hinges |
| Loose Handles | Worn screws or harmed hardware | Tighten or change screws and handles |
Step-by-Step Repair Guide
1. Addressing Warped Doors
Deformed doors can be a significant problem, especially if they prevent the door from closing properly. Here's how to resolve this issue:
- Assess the Warp: Use a level to determine how warped the door is.
- Adjust the Hinges: Tightening or loosening up the hinges can often solve small warping. If the door is significantly warped, you might need to eliminate it, sand it down, or replace it.
- Think About Environmental Control: Installing a dehumidifier or utilizing weather seals might assist prevent future warping.
2. Fixing Misalignment
Misalignment can trigger the doors to rub against the frame or prevent appropriate closure. Here's how to repair it:
- Check Hinges: Ensure that all screws in the hinges are tight. Loose screws can cause misalignment.
- Usage Shims: If the door frame is uneven, adding shims can assist realign the door.
- Adjust Strike Plates: If the latch doesn't line up with the strike plate, think about rearranging the strike plate.
3. Replacing Broken Glass
If your double French door or broken glass pane, instant action is essential to keep security and insulation.
- Remove the Door Panel: Unscrew the door panel carefully.
- Change the Glass: You can either change the glass pane or set up a new door if the damage is substantial.
- Seal Properly: Ensure that any brand-new glass is sealed correctly to prevent drafts.
4. Sealing Drafts and Air Leaks
Drafty doors can lead to increased energy bills. Here's how to seal them:
- Inspect Weather Stripping: Look for any used or damaged weather condition removing.
- Change Stripping: Remove old weather removing and apply new, guaranteeing a snug fit versus the door frame.
- Test for Leaks: Use a candle or incense stick to spot drafts around the door.
5. Solving Lock Issues
A sticking lock can be frustrating and may avoid safe and secure closure.
- Clean the Mechanism: Use a little brush to remove dust and debris from the lock and latch.
- Lube: Apply graphite or silicone spray to the lock mechanism to boost functionality.
- Change If Necessary: If the lock stays bothersome, consider replacing it with a brand-new one.
6. Attending To Squeaky Hinges
Squeaky hinges can be an inconvenience, however they are easily fixable.
- Oil Hinges: Use a silicone lubricant or grease to peaceful squeaky hinges.
- Look for Rust: If the hinges are rusty, think about changing them entirely for smoother operation.
7. Tightening Up Loose Handles
Loose handles can affect door operation and security. Here's how to fix them:
- Check Screws: Tighten any screws that are loose.
- Replace Hardware: If the handle is broken, it may be advantageous to change it.
Maintenance Tips for Double French Doors
To guarantee the longevity of double French doors, think about implementing these maintenance tips:
- Regular Inspections: Check for indications of wear, such as rust, warping, or chips in the paint.
- Clean Thoroughly: Clean both the glass and frame routinely to maintain visual appeal.
- Oil Hardware: Regularly oil the locks and hinges to keep them working efficiently.
- Monitor Weather Stripping: Regularly check and change weather condition stripping as needed.
- Paint and Stain: Repaint or stain the doors every few years to safeguard wood from the components.
